Transaction 1eca2f56633cbf039fc0925384e6d340b812cc6af5c147e9ef4fe2c8e702694a
1 Input
1 Output
-
1eca2f56633cbf039fc0925384e6d340b812cc6af5c147e9ef4fe2c8e702694a:0
- value
- 343398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7f33809c876bfaef5220450a2c374ea091d6204 OP_EQUAL
- address
- 3QJ4C55wcvcCPyFC7cavVzmF8S4iwFbgNh